Understanding Honeycomb Panel Structure and its Impact on Edge Banding
Honeycomb panels consist of a core of hexagonal cells sandwiched between two surface layers, typically MDF, particleboard, or plywood. This structure, while lightweight and strong, introduces some unique challenges for edge banding. The core’s inherent instability and potential for slight variations in thickness can lead to inconsistencies during the bonding process. The surface layers, too, can impact the outcome. If the surface isn’t perfectly smooth and flat, the adhesive may not distribute evenly, resulting in gaps. The cellular structure also means there's less surface area for adhesive to grip compared to solid core materials, making proper preparation crucial.
Common Causes of Gaps in Honeycomb Panel Edge Banding
Several factors can contribute to the formation of gaps in honeycomb panel edge banding. These include:
Insufficient Adhesive Application: Inadequate adhesive coverage is a primary culprit. This can stem from using the wrong type of adhesive, applying it unevenly, or using insufficient pressure to ensure proper penetration and bonding. Honeycomb panels require an adhesive specifically designed for their porous nature and the demands of edge banding applications.
Improper Temperature and Pressure: The bonding process requires specific temperature and pressure parameters to achieve a strong and gap-free bond. Insufficient heat may prevent the adhesive from activating fully, while insufficient pressure prevents proper contact between the banding and the panel. Temperature and pressure settings should be carefully calibrated for the specific adhesive and honeycomb panel material being used.
Panel Surface Irregularities: Uneven surfaces on the honeycomb panel edge, including scratches, dents, or variations in thickness, prevent uniform adhesive distribution and create gaps. Pre-finishing the edges of the honeycomb panels with sanding or planing is vital to ensure a smooth surface for optimal bonding.
Moisture Content Variations: Fluctuations in the moisture content of the honeycomb panel can cause expansion and contraction, leading to gaps after the adhesive cures. Maintaining a stable environment with controlled humidity and temperature during both production and storage is crucial.
Incorrect Edge Banding Material Selection: Choosing the wrong type of edge banding can also contribute to gaps. The banding material should be compatible with the adhesive and the honeycomb panel substrate. The flexibility of the banding should also be considered, as rigid banding might not conform well to the panel edge.
Poor Quality Control: Inconsistent application techniques, inadequate equipment maintenance, and insufficient quality control during production can all contribute to the formation of gaps. A rigorous quality control process throughout the production line is essential for preventing this problem.
Preventive Measures and Best Practices
Preventing gaps in honeycomb panel edge banding requires a proactive approach throughout the production process. Key steps include:
Panel Preparation: Ensuring the honeycomb panel edges are clean, smooth, and free from any irregularities before applying the edge banding is critical. Proper sanding and planing are essential.
Adhesive Selection and Application: Using a high-quality adhesive specifically designed for honeycomb panels is paramount. Employ consistent and thorough adhesive application techniques to guarantee full coverage. Consider using automatic adhesive application systems for consistent results.
Precise Temperature and Pressure Control: Carefully calibrate the temperature and pressure settings of your edge banding equipment to optimize the bonding process for your specific materials. Regular maintenance of this equipment is vital for consistent performance.
Moisture Control: Maintain a stable environment with controlled temperature and humidity during both production and storage to minimize moisture-related issues.
Quality Control Checks: Implement rigorous quality control checks throughout the production process, including visual inspections of the finished product to identify and address any gaps.
Solutions for Existing Gaps
While prevention is the best approach, if gaps already exist, several solutions can be employed, depending on the severity of the issue and the type of finish:
Filling Compounds: Small gaps can often be effectively filled using appropriate wood fillers, carefully matched to the color of the edge banding. These fillers should be applied smoothly and sanded flush after drying.
Re-banding: For larger or more significant gaps, re-banding may be necessary. This involves removing the existing banding and applying a new band, ensuring proper attention to the preventive measures outlined above.
Edge Covering Solutions: In some cases, applying a decorative edge covering, such as a veneer or metal edging, can conceal existing gaps.
